The United Arab Emirates offers a diverse range of activities and experiences that cater to various interests. One of the most prominent destinations is Dubai, known for its modern architecture and luxury shopping. Visitors can explore the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world, which provides stunning views of the city from its observation deck. Another highlight in Dubai is the Dubai Mall, which features an extensive array of shops, dining options, and entertainment, including an indoor ice rink and an aquarium.
For those interested in culture and history, the Dubai Museum in Al Fahidi Fort offers insights into the region's heritage. Nearby, the Sheikh Mohammed Centre for Cultural Understanding provides opportunities to learn about Emirati culture through guided tours and traditional meals.
In contrast, Abu Dhabi, the capital of the UAE, is home to the magnificent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que, an architectural marvel that welcomes visitors of all backgrounds. The Louvre Abu Dhabi is another cultural gem, showcasing a broad collection of art and artifacts that highlight the interconnectedness of human civilization.
Nature enthusiasts can venture into the Liwa Desert, where they can experience the vast dunes and possibly engage in activities like dune bashing or camel riding. The Hatta region, located in the Hajar Mountains, offers opportunities for hiking, kayaking, and exploring traditional villages.
For those seeking leisure, the coastline of the UAE provides beautiful beaches and luxurious resorts. Jumeirah Beach in Dubai is particularly popular, offering a vibrant atmosphere and a range of water sports. In addition, the Yas Island in Abu Dhabi features attractions like Yas Waterworld and Ferrari World, catering to families and thrill-seekers alike.
Lastly, the Fujairah emirate offers a different landscape, with its stunning beaches and the Hajar Mountains. Visitors can explore historical sites like the Fujairah Fort and engage in activities such as snorkeling and diving in the clear waters of the Gulf of Oman.
Overall, the UAE provides a blend of modernity and tradition, making it a unique destination for travelers.
